In 2019, average wage of employed persons for Shanghai was 149,377 yuan. Average wage of employed persons of Shanghai increased from 66,115 yuan in 2010 to 149,377 yuan in 2019 growing at an average annual rate of 9.53%. What is a good monthly salary in Shanghai? The Government of Nepal legally abolished the caste-system and criminalized any caste-based discrimination, including “untouchability” (the ostracism of a specific caste) – in 1963. In accordance with the law, citizens of all countries except India require a visa to enter Nepal. In January 2014, Nepal introduced an online visa application system. The Laccadive Sea or Lakshadweep Sea is a body of water bordering India (including its Lakshadweep islands), the Maldives, and Sri Lanka.
